Should I rent an Airbnb for a party in Sydney?

Harbour View Restaurant in Barangaroo at heart of Sydney
Source: Peerspace

We’ll start by addressing this concern since it’s pretty important to the question of how to locate a suitable party venue.

The answer is no – Airbnb isn’t a great tool for finding party venues. However, we can suggest a suitable alternative in the form of Peerspace, which is the largest online marketplace for hourly venue rentals of all kinds.

Anyone who’s stayed at an Airbnb while traveling knows that the site has lots of excellent options when it comes to travel-related lodging. However, Airbnb isn’t designed to connect users with event venues, and you’ll probably hit some dead ends if you try to use the platform for that purpose.

Consider that Airbnb rentals happen in 24-hour blocks. If your party is only going to last a few hours, you wouldn’t even be using the space you’re renting for the majority rental period, which means you’re spending more money than you need to. Compare this to Peerspace, where you can rent venues by the hour for exactly as long as you need the space.

Another significant issue with seeking an Airbnb for a party in Sydney? For one thing, many Airbnb hosts won’t want you to use the space you’re renting from them as a party venue. In fact, Airbnb codified a ban against hosting parties in its properties. So you and the venue’s host can get fined or kicked off the platform if you even try to throw a party in an Airbnb venue.
